Read MoreThe global Gold Plating Chemicals Market was valued at USD 561.6 million in 2025 and is projected to expand at a steady CAGR of 4.9% to reach approximately USD 863.8 million by 2035, driven by sustained electronics connector, contact, and printed circuit board gold plating demand, growing semiconductor component and telecommunications equipment gold-plated interconnect consumption, and continued adoption of selective and hard gold plating processes above blanket soft gold plating for cost-optimized precious metal usage. The market encompasses electrolyte solutions, cleaning chemicals, and plating additives consumed across electronics, jewelry, aerospace and defense, and medical device manufacturing applications.

How does electronics connector and PCB demand drive gold plating chemicals market growth?
Electronics connectors, contacts, and printed circuit board manufacturing rely on gold plating for corrosion resistance and reliable electrical conductivity, sustaining structured baseline demand from electronics manufacturers, with continued global electronics production volume sustaining above-baseline electronics-application gold plating chemical procurement.
What role does semiconductor component plating play in market growth?
Semiconductor component and telecommunications equipment gold-plated interconnect applications sustain structured demand from semiconductor packaging and assembly accounts, with continued semiconductor manufacturing capacity investment sustaining above-baseline semiconductor-application gold plating chemical procurement.
How does selective and hard gold plating process adoption sustain market growth?
Selective and hard gold plating processes — optimizing precious metal usage through targeted deposition above blanket soft gold plating — sustain structured process-chemistry-mix transition from electronics manufacturers seeking cost-efficient plating chemical formulations, supporting above-blanket-plating-process gold plating chemical market value growth.
What is driving demand for gold plating chemicals in aerospace and defense applications?
Aerospace and defense component manufacturing — including infrared reflectors, radar components, and connector applications — sustains structured demand for high-reliability gold plating chemical formulations above commercial-grade plating chemistry baseline, supporting above-commodity-grade market value growth from aerospace and defense manufacturing accounts.
